Optical system for automatic color monitoring in heterogeneous media during vinification processes
2019
Abstract Wine is one of the most important food products worldwide. However, the application of technologies to the winemaking process can improve. An RGBC optical sensor, used to measure color intensity and shade, was developed and tested in real environments. It is able to measure samples without filtering by offering the color intensity and shade of a filtered sample. Color intensity can be measured within the range of 1.5 and 9.5 color points with an approximate 3% error. The model for shade can be applied to red wines with an approximate 1% error. Diversity in random subspacing ensembles
2004
Ensembles of learnt models constitute one of the main current directions in machine learning and data mining. It was shown experimentally and theoretically that in order for an ensemble to be effective, it should consist of classifiers having diversity in their predictions. A number of ways are known to quantify diversity in ensembles, but little research has been done about their appropriateness. In this paper, we compare eight measures of the ensemble diversity with regard to their correlation with the accuracy improvement due to ensembles. Realistic Implementation of the Particle Model for the Visualization of Nanoparticle Precipitation and Growth
2019
An application for visualizing the aggregation of structureless atoms is presented. The application allows us to demonstrate on a qualitative basis, as well as by quantitatively monitoring the aggregate surface/volume ratio, that the enhanced reactivity of nanoparticles can be connected with their large specific surface. It is suggested that, along with the use of geometric analogies, this bottom-up approach can be effective in discussing the enhanced reactivity proprieties of nanoparticles. On Behavioral Heterogeneity
2006
An index of “behavioral heterogeneity” for every finite population of households is defined. It is shown that the higher the index of behavioral heterogeneity the less sensitive depends the aggregate consumption expenditure ratio upon prices. As a consequence, a high index implies a tendency for the Jacobian of aggregate demand to have a dominant negative diagonal.
A Short-Term Data Based Water Consumption Prediction Approach
2019
A smart water network consists of a large number of devices that measure a wide range of parameters present in distribution networks in an automatic and continuous way. Among these data, you can find the flow, pressure, or totalizer measurements that, when processed with appropriate algorithms, allow for leakage detection at an early stage. These algorithms are mainly based on water demand forecasting. Different approaches for the prediction of water demand are available in the literature. Although they present successful results at different levels, they have two main drawbacks: the inclusion of several seasonalities is quite cumbersome, and the fitting horizons are not very large. The Cultural Dimension of Spanish Universities: The state of the issue
2020
The cultural dimension of Spanish universities has changed markedly, especially since the restoration of democracy in Spain in the late 1970s. This study reflects on the terminology and the historical evolution of Spanish universities, comparing their development within a broader world context. It also analyses the present state of affairs through two complementary pieces of field work. The paper concludes by examining the issues and hurdles that until recently were the third dimension of university life after teaching and research.

Digital Servitization: Strategies for Handling Customization and Customer Interaction
2021
This conceptual chapter utilizes extant servitization and digitalization theorization and discusses the impact of digital servitization on customization/standardization and customer interaction. The study argues that the transformation toward digital servitization is complex and goes far beyond the technological dimension. The study contributes to the digital servitization literature by demonstrating that industrial services shift from customized and co-created to mainly standardized-provided and informating when they are digitalized. These insights can assist managers of servitized manufacturing firms who wish to utilize digital technologies in their service provision.
